yes 400rwhp is very possible with a gt35r and thicker hg ect.. Your going to need to search and learn alot more about it if you want to make a custom kit.If you dont want to do this just go with the Technique tuning stage 2 like mentioned above. Otherwise your going to need to research ALOT more. It takes alot more than that to make a turbo kit, dont forget injectors, gauges, exhaust, clutch, bov, wastegate ect ect.. those are just off the top of my head but there is much more. Custom kits are still alot of money.
